Fintech Avista Secures a Warehousing Credit Line from Accial Capital to Disburse up to $100 million to Support Colombian Pensioners.

Bogotá-based startup Avista has announced it has raised up to $20 million in a warehousing credit line from the impact investment firm Accial Capital. Accial Capital Invests in Pintek to Support the Indonesian Education Ecosystem.

January 11th, 2021, Jakarta, Indonesia — Pintek, a fintech platform that provides credit to students and their families, educational institutions, and their suppliers, raised a $21 million debt facility from Accial Capital, a US-based impact-focused private debt investor. AwanTunai raises up to $20M in debt funding to digitize Indonesia’s cash economy.
